what is the logic circuit of 8:3 encoder and 3:8 decoder?
Answer Posted / mathi
8:3 encoder has 8 input lines and 3 output lines.Each input lines influencing all the output lines basically its corresponding binary format. If there are selection lines it is a multiplexer; not an encoder.
3:8 decoder has 3 input lines and 8 output lines with each output representing one of minterms of 3 inputs. its just the reverse of encoder.
